Section 1.3. Referenced Documents and Organizations
1.3.1. Referenced Documents
1.3.1.1. Effective Date
1) Unless otherwise specified herein, the documents referenced in this Code shall
include all amendments, revisions, reaffirmations, reapprovals, addenda and
supplements effective to 30 September 2009.
1.3.1.2. Applicable Editions
1) Where documents are referenced in this Code, they shall be the editions designated
in Table 1.3.1.2. (See Appendix A.)
